Creating a Professional Cleaning Services Proposal

A successful business proposal for cleaning services must go beyond a simple price list. Procurement officers look for a detailed operational plan, evidence of quality control, and a clear understanding of the facility's specific needs. Whether you are bidding for a school district contract or a corporate office, your response must demonstrate reliability and a commitment to health and safety standards.

While a sample PDF provides a helpful structure, the most competitive bids are those tailored specifically to the client's pain points. Cleaning Proposal FAQ

What sections should be in a cleaning services proposal?

A professional proposal should include a company overview, a detailed scope of work, a quality assurance plan, health and safety certifications, and references from similar contracts.

How do I handle the 'Experience' section if I'm a new business?

Focus on the certifications of your lead staff, the specific training your team has undergone, and the detailed methodology you will use to ensure quality.

Should I provide a PDF or a Word document for my bid?

Always follow the RFP instructions. If the buyer requests a specific format or a response matrix, ensure your final export matches those requirements exactly.
